Your First Day
Your first day will begin with a Welcome Session, where you will receive essential information about your placement, meet your team, and get acquainted with Sydney Adventist Hospital.
Welcome Session
Time
The Welcome Session will run from 8.00am to 4.00pm. Plan to arrive a few minutes early to ensure a smooth start.
Where to Meet
Meet at The Hub, Level 4 (Main Reception). A member of the San Education team will be there to greet you.
What to Bring
- Your student name badge - to be worn at all times during placement
- Photo identification e.g. drivers' licence, to confirm your identity on arrival
Uniforms
Please ensure you are dressed according to the following standards:
- Learning provider clinical placement shirt - no long sleeves
- Navy blue or black tailored slacks or trousers (no jeans or stretch pants)
- Dark blue or black closed-in shoes (leather or waterproof; no fabric material)
- Hair tied back or cut to collar length
- Clean, short, non-lacquered nails
- Minimal jewellery (ear studs or sleepers only)
Absences
If you are unable to attend the Welcome Session, you must notify the Education Coordinator on 02 9480 9039 as soon as possible.
Your education provider may have additional requirements for declaring absence. All leave requires a medical certificate.
Students should not schedule medical appointments, work commitments, or social engagements during placement hours.
